本文為英文版的機器翻譯版本,如內容有任何歧義或不一致之處,概以英文版為準。
規劃程序
補充需求是根據項目的已設定網路拓撲來計算。以下是範例網路拓撲,用於描述產生補充訂單時涉及的各種計算。

Auto Replenishment 會產生從輻節點到中樞節點 (例如,區域 DCs到中央 DC) 的傳輸需求,並產生從中樞節點到供應商 (例如,中央 DC 到供應商) 的購買需求。以下步驟涉及產生補充訂單。這些步驟會針對補充規劃範圍內的每個產品和網站組合重複執行。來自下游節點的要求會根據來源規則資訊在上游傳播,而程序會在上游節點重複,直到到達該項目的根節點為止。

需求處理 – 根據補充計畫組態 AWS Supply Chain 準備歷史需求或預測資料。需求或預測會根據補充計劃組態設定,在產品、網站、日或週層級進行處理。如果在更詳細的層級提供銷售歷史記錄或預測資料,例如產品、網站、客戶或產品、網站、管道,則會在產品和網站層級彙總這些資料。同樣地,如果在週層級設定補充計畫,則會進行逐週彙總。在上述範例中,需求是從區域 DCs的輻節點取得,並在產品、網站和日/週層級彙總。如果使用消耗量或需求型庫存政策,則會使用過去 30 天的需求量 (銷售歷史記錄) 來計算平均消耗量。
目標庫存層級 – 使用需求或預測以及設定的庫存政策,來判斷特定期間內的目標庫存層級。自動補充支援兩種不同的補充模型。
預測驅動的補充
以使用量為基礎的補充
AWS Supply Chain 根據預測產生庫存目標。這些庫存目標是根據前置時間和採購排程來決定,以確保庫存層級考量需求和供應前置時間的差異性。
轉移或購買需求 – AWS Supply Chain 每個期間從供應 (現有 + 隨需庫存) 到將庫存投影到未來時間的淨需求。 會將預計庫存層級 AWS Supply Chain 維持在與上一個步驟中計算的目標庫存層級相同的層級。預計庫存層級和目標庫存層級之間的差異是淨供應需求或重新訂購數量 (RoQ)。 AWS Supply Chain 套用最低訂單數量,或訂購多個數量以產生最終轉移需求或購買需求 (POR)。 AWS Supply Chain 會使用轉移或廠商前置時間,依日期決定訂單。批次大小的預設值為 1.0,最低訂單數量為 0。
計算邏輯
rounding=f(RoQ,MOQ,Lot_Size) =Lot_Size×Max(RoQ,MOQ)
上述公式說明 Auto Replenishment 中的四捨五入邏輯。 AWS Supply Chain 會先比較重新排序數量 RoQ 和最小訂購數量 MOQ、取得最終訂單提案,然後乘以實際數量的批次大小係數。批次大小是在具有 欄位 qty_multiple 的來源規則實體中設定。
需求傳播 – 對於輻節點, AWS Supply Chain 使用來源規則來查詢父節點並將傳輸需求傳播到上游節點。透過轉移前置時間來確定父節點所需的日期,來 AWS Supply Chain 取消所需的交付日期。 AWS Supply Chain 僅支援單一來源。當集線器節點下所有子節點或輻節點完成此步驟時, 會在集線器節點上 AWS Supply Chain 重複上述步驟。此程序會重複執行,直到到達項目拓撲中的根節點為止。
自動補充只會顯示面向廠商的網站的採購訂單請求。面向廠商的網站有兩種:
提供其他網站的供應商面向網站
未提供其他網站的供應商面向網站
對於提供其他網站的供應商面向站點,重新排序數量是來自其子站點的重新排序數量,以及來自其自身需求的獨立重新排序數量。對於未提供其他網站的供應商面向網站,會根據網站的需求預測來計算重新排序數量。面向廠商網站的獨立重新排序數量遵循重新排序數量運算中的相同邏輯。相依需求是所有子網站的總和。如果涵蓋天數為 7,則 RoQ 是涵蓋期間內所有訂單數量的總和。下列範例顯示規劃期間中的案例,其中每個站點只有一個訂單,並說明運算。